    Features
    Empire: Total War will feature a new game engine as well as 3D naval battles, a feature new to the series, as well as large land battles with muskets, cavalry and artillery. Buildings and structures can be garrisoned, as well as being destructible, and there is a plethora of new formations and strategies to be mastered. The naval battles feature destructible sails, realistic cannon fire, grapeshots and boarding action. Weather effects are also a key chapter in naval battles.

    The battles on land have been given a makeover too:

    * The firing of cannons, arrows and muskets is made more realistic.
    * Music makes its way into the battlefield in the form of bagpipes, drums, fifes and trumpets.
    * Weapons may jam and misfire, and cannons can explode.
    * Generals shout orders at their troops as the regiment goes into combat or fires at enemies.
    * The battlefield becomes strewn with dead, dying and dismembered bodies. The game makes use of ragdoll physics to add to the chaos.

    Shogun Total War was released in June, Medieval Totalwar in August, Rome: Totalwar in September and Medieval2: Total War in May.

    A release around Christmas can be a commercial advantage.

    I wonder if it involves buying/using the engine which is use for the Age of Pirate game (by Akella) for their naval battle portion of the ETW...
    Most definetly not.

    The naval battles are entirely home grown in the CA UK Horsham office.

    The guys working on Naval Battles would be quite upset to think that they werent getting the credit they so hugely deserve.
